天天看點

web前端開發技術

作者:一隻開發小蟲蟲

Web前端開發涵蓋的知識面非常廣,既有具體的技術,又有抽象的理念。簡單地說,其主要職能是把網站的界面更好地呈現給使用者,主要工作領域是浏覽器端。

web前端開發技術

1、核心技術包括 JavaScript,css,html 等。還要處理伺服器通信,以及部分伺服器腳本開發的工作,比如釋出、測試腳本,jsp、php頁面腳本。有時還要與産品經理共同完成一些互動設計。WEB前端處于設計與背景的中間領域,起到承上啟下的作用。

2、Web前端開發技術主要包括三個要素:HTML、CSS和JavaScript

3、系統學習html和css

4、深刻了解Javascript

一名優秀的前端程式員,必須深刻去了解Javascript 的原理,機制、本源、基于對象的本質,掌握相關知識基礎理論。

web前端開發技術

Web前端開發技術入門簡單,深入困難。Web前端開發工作技術員要熟練學習基礎的Web開發技術,關于網站性能的美化、SEO以及基礎的關于伺服器端方面的知識;另一方面還對開發人員要求能夠熟練且靈敏的使用各類工具,輔助開發。

web前端開發技術

前端開發技術涵蓋了Javascript, CSS等傳統的技術和Adobe RIA, Google Gears,概念性比較強的互動式設計以及含有濃厚的藝術色彩的視覺設計等。

前端技術有:JavaScript、ActionScript、CSS、xHTML等“傳統”技術與Adobe AIR、Google Gears,以及概念性較強的互動式設計,藝術性較強的視覺設計等。

web前端開發技術

5.jQuery架構

a.特性

資料存儲在浏覽器中;頁面重新整理不丢失資料;容量大;隻能存儲字元串,對象需要編碼。

b.window.sessionStroage

生命周期為關閉浏覽器視窗;在同一個視窗下資料可以共享;以鍵值對的形式存儲使用。

c.window.localStorage

生命周期永久生效,除非手動删除,否則關閉頁面也會存在;可以多視窗共享;以鍵值對存儲。

web前端開發技術

6.Vue架構

是一套用于建構使用者界面的漸進式JavaScript架構。與其它架構不同的是,Vue被設計為可以自底向上逐層應用。Vue的核心庫隻關注視圖層,友善與第三方庫或既有項目整合。另一方面,Vue 完全有能力驅動采用單檔案元件和Vue生态系統支援的庫開發的複雜單頁應用。

web前端開發技術

7.react架構

a.主要功能

用于建構UI。可以在React裡傳遞多種類型的參數,如聲明代碼,幫助開發者渲染出UI、也可以是靜态的HTML DOM元素、也可以傳遞動态變量、甚至是可互動的應用元件。

b.特點

聲明式設計、元件化、高效、靈活

web前端開發技術

繼續閱讀